建站知识

301重定向怎么做

来源:赢德科技  日期:2016-9-23 17:12:45  浏览次数:

  好多人给出了用301重定向技术,那什么事301重定向呢?

  在济南网站建设网站建设中,时常会遇到需要网页重定向的情况:像网站调整,如改变网页目录结构,网页被移到一个新地址,再或者,网页扩展名改变,如因应用需要把.php改成.Html或.shtml,在这种情况下,如果不做重定向,则用户收藏夹或搜索引擎数据库中旧地址只能让访问客户还会得到一个404页面错误信息,访问流量白白丧失;再如某些注册了多个域名的网站,也需要通过重定向让访问这些域名的用户自动跳转到主站点,等等。

  创建一个.htaccess文件,并将下面提供的代码写入文件内,它可以确保旧域名所有的目录或者网页正确的跳转到新域名内。 

  记住.htaccess文件一定要放在旧网站的根目录下,并且新网站要和旧网站保持相同的目录结构及网页文件 

  Options +FollowSymLinks 

  RewriteEngine on 

  RewriteRule (.*) /$1 [R=301,L] 

  请将上面的http://www.jnydkj.com修改成你想要跳转到的域名。 

  此外,我建议大家归总旧网站的外部链接,并联系相应的站点修改导入链链的URL,以指向新站点。 

  注意:.htaccess文件只有在使用安装有Mod Rewrite模块的Apache作为WEB服务器的Linux主机上才能起作用

  配置完成后,一定认真检查一下是否正确。Internet有很多类似的Server Header检查工具,如Check Server Headers Tool – HTTP Status Codes Checker

  网站重定向的注意事项

  1.若准备将服务器上的文件移到其它地方时,须就以下信息正确地通知搜索引擎的爬行程序: 

  - 目标地址:这些文件被移向何方 

  - 移动属性:暂时移走还是永久性移走 

  2.对拥有多个域名的网站,专家建议应把那些不想在搜索引擎上推广的域名用301跳转命令来永久性重定向。 

  编辑本段确保网站实施了正确的301重定向

  对于正确实施301重定向,有这样几个方法可供大家参考: 

  1.在.htaccess文件中增加301重定向指令 

  2.适用于使用Unix网络服务器的用户。通过此指令通知搜索引擎的spider你的站点文件不在此地址下。这是较为常用的办法。

  3.在服务器软件的系统管理员配置区完成301重定向 

  适用于使用Window网络服务器的用户 

  4.采用“mod_rewrite”技术 

  通过该技术进行的改变将在.htaccess文件中体现出来,形如: 

  Options +FollowSymLinks 

  RewriteEngine on 

  RewriteCond % ^yourdomain.com 

  RewriteRule ^(.*)$ /$1 [R=permanent,L] 

  5.用ASP/PHP实现301重定向: 

  代码在上面已经介绍过了

  想要了解更多详情欢迎来电咨询18678812288,或登陆网址www.jnydkj.com。联系人:王经理。地址:济南市舜耕路泉城公园东门园内向北50米


服务知名客户

佰诗奴 齐鲁动保 sai shinegee 百世指尖 丽达 科捷 感知 华美医院 创想餐饮... 晟华制药 济南亿民动物药业有限公司 山东骏腾医疗科技有限公司 凤凰眼镜 欧丽家居 艺拍中国 济南王者教育 娜氏婚礼策划工作室
Copyright 2016-2018 山东赢德信息科技有限公司所有 鲁ICP备证100953号 关于我们| 联系我们| 付款方式| 网站案例| 新闻资讯| TXT网站地图| XML地图